EXECUTIVE SUMMARY

PIVOT––the Progressive Vietnamese American Organization––was formed to be a collective voice for progressive Vietnamese Americans who seek a just and diverse America. In 2017, PIVOT was established in direct response to a political landscape and physical environment that threatened the human rights and safety of millions of Americans, particularly disenfranchised populations. (These include communities composed of those who are low-income, immigrants, refugees, people of color, LGBTQ+, and women.) Across the U.S., Vietnamese Americans with progressive values united to empower and engage fellow Vietnamese Americans to work together towards a better future. 

What continues to be key to these efforts is our ability to advocate for policies that align with our values regarding: 1) promoting civil and human rights (including for immigrant, refugee, and LGBTQ+ communities), 2) increasing cultural, linguistic, and financial access to quality education, health care, and economic opportunities, 3) protecting the environment, 4) combating misinformation and disinformation, and 5) building inclusive coalitions and intergenerational community.

To that end, we are focusing on six key priorities: immigration, health, civil rights, environmental justice, economic justice, and LGBTQ+ rights. Our goals for these priorities are outlined below:

Immigration

  • Protect immigrants’ and asylum seekers’ rights.

  • Support a pathway to citizenship for non-citizens.

  • End abusive enforcement and detention.

  • Demand and advocate for due process and humane policies in deportation proceedings.

  • Promote and advocate for immigration issues specific to Vietnamese American communities.

Health

  • Preserve and expand affordable health coverage.

  • Ensure that everyone has a right to quality health care, regardless of immigration status, sexual orientation, gender identity, and language or other cultural barriers.

  • Promote awareness and protect the use of mental health services.

  • Advance reproductive justice to promote health and well-being.

  • Eliminate and address the root causes of health disparities (disproportionate burdens of health issues in select populations) for Vietnamese Americans.

Civil Rights

  • Advocate for equal access to justice, health care, and other vital systems and services.

  • Preserve and expand access to voting rights for Vietnamese Americans and other marginalized populations.

  • Support all efforts to count Vietnamese Americans comprehensively and fully in key datasets, such as those administered by the U.S. Census Bureau.

  • Stand in solidarity with other marginalized communities on pressing civil rights issues.

  • Ensure equal access to economic prosperity by promoting fair protections for all workers.

Environmental Justice 

  • Inform Vietnamese Americans of the urgency of climate change.

  • Mobilize to take immediate action to combat climate change.

  • Elevate key climate issues that impact Vietnamese American communities to a broader audience, including mainstream environmental justice organizations.

  • Support research efforts to better understand the impact of climate change and environmental factors that impact the quality of life for Vietnamese Americans.

Economic Justice

  • Protect social safety net programs and equitable access to them for all Americans, including immigrants and refugees.

  • Advocate for people’s rights to living wages, housing, education, health care, a clean environment, food, and safety. 

  • Fight for pay equality through an intersectional lens (i.e. by considering how different facets of our identities such as race, class, gender, disability, and immigration may affect our experiences and needs), especially for gender justice.

  • Advocate for fair and equitable access to funding and resources for small businesses, including the availability of services in Vietnamese.

  • Promote legislation that invests public resources into communities of color, breaks down barriers for marginalized communities to build wealth, passes progressive taxes to pay for reparations, and creates policies with an anti-racist lens.

LGBTQ+ Rights

  • Raise public awareness of policies that affect the accessibility of health care, gender-affirming care, and mental health care for the LGBTQ+ community, their family members, and allies. 

  • Support policies that foster LGBTQ+ communities’ health, well-being, and rights so that they may thrive in a just society.

  • Advocate for educational efforts and research studies on the disproportionately higher rate of suicide and mental health crises in the Vietnamese American LGBTQ+ community.

  • Stand in solidarity with other LGBTQ+ partner organizations and collaborators to provide a safe space to exchange ideas, build trust, support intergenerational resources for families, have representation, and advocate for policy changes.
